Output 908ed330fafcab32264cb0e5d2a5a3aa6584a467f3a91cf02ed8130551d99af6:15

value
23424961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509664cb340aeb5916853dbb8213b9e412463d63 OP_EQUALVERIFY OP_CHECKSIG
address
LSa4V6gGZSyoBjfjj7idijRCxxfqMNByk1
transaction
908ed330fafcab32264cb0e5d2a5a3aa6584a467f3a91cf02ed8130551d99af6
spent
true